OSP investigates Athena traffic crash injured Pendleton couple.

Oregon State Police continues to investigate a serious injury traffic crash that happened Thursday afternoon along Highway 11 near Athena in Umatilla County.

The crash was reported shortly before 12:55 p.m., when a 1996 Honda Civic driven by Gregory Murray, 44, of Milton-Freewater, was heading southbound on the highway near milepost 15.

The Civic was passing several vehicles when it faced a northbound 1996 Toyota Camry, driven by Jim Rasmussen, 77, of Pendleton. Both drivers took evasive action but collided in the vicinity of the northbound lanes and shoulder, said a OSP spokesman.

Murray and his adult female passenger received minor injuries that did not require hospital transport.

Rasmussen and his passenger, 74-year-old Donna Rasmussen, received serious but non-life threatening injuries.

They were taken to St. Anthony Hospital for treatment.
